Mallory 2011 Track Layout
As you all now know we have booked Mallory Park for ND 2011 :agree:
As this will be the 3rd time we have been to this venue Mallory have offered us a few options to mix things up a bit in terms of track Layout.
You will see the track layout below which shows a number of extra corners that can be added.
https://www.rtoc.org/files/Club%20fil...es/mallory.JPG
The bus stop is purely for bikes so that one is out but the other two are possible.
So the options are:
Leave it as it was in the previous 2 years i.e the normal track.
Normal Track Plus Charlies & Stapletons.
Normal Track Plus Edwinas.
Normal Track plus Charlies & Stapletons AND Edwinas.
You can select more than one option if you like, say you weren't bothered which chicane was added but wanted at least one you could select both.
We dont want to change the layout once its fixed becasue it could be dangerous if you went out in the morning on the normal track and then suddenly a new corner appeared in your second session.
Mallory don't need this information until 2 weeks before the event so I will let this run until Friday the 20th of May.
